Numerous experimental and theoretical studies on recycled aggregate concrete have been carried out in China in the past 10 years. This paper provides a comprehensive review of the related findings of research on the mechanical properties of RAC in China. The influences of the RCA on the strength and deformation characteristics of concrete, the statistical characteristics for the strength of RAC, fracture energy, stress-strain relationships under uniaxial compression, uniaxial tension as well as pure shear, and the residual strength of RAC after exposure to high temperatures, the bond between RAC and different kinds of steel rebar were also reviewed. Furthermore, some recent studies on the numerical simulation of the failure mechanism for RAC at the meso-structure level were discussed. © 2012 Science China Press and Springer-Verlag Berlin Heidelberg.
